Hi, @vinoth
1, Hoodie*Config classes are only used to set default value when call their build method currently. They will be replaced by HoodieMemoryOptions, HoodieIndexOptions, HoodieHBaseIndexOptions, etc... 2, I don't understand the question "It is not clear to me whether there is any external facing changes which changes this model.".
